Mallorca boasts a variety of family-friendly beaches, each offering its own unique charm and amenities that cater to visitors of all ages. One of the most popular choices is Alcudia Beach, known for its stunning stretch of fine white sand and shallow, crystal-clear waters that are perfect for young children. The beach features a wide array of facilities, including sun loungers, beachside restaurants, and water sports activities, ensuring that families can enjoy a full day of fun in the sun. The shallow waters make it a safe environment for little ones to splash around, while the nearby promenade offers opportunities for leisurely strolls and ice cream stops.
Another fantastic option is Pollenca Beach, which is slightly quieter than Alcudia yet equally beautiful. This beach is characterized by its picturesque backdrop of the Tramuntana mountains and offers calm waters ideal for swimming and paddling. Families can also enjoy various amenities, including shaded areas and beachside cafes, where parents can relax while keeping an eye on their children. Additionally, the nearby town of Pollenca is charming, with cobblestone streets and local markets, perfect for a family outing after a day at the beach.
For a more secluded experience, consider Cala Millor, which features a long, sandy beach with gentle waves. This beach is well-equipped for families, with numerous playgrounds and shallow areas that are safe for young swimmers. The promenade is lined with shops and eateries, providing plenty of opportunities for families to explore and enjoy local cuisine. All of these beaches not only offer beautiful scenery and safe swimming conditions but also have a welcoming atmosphere that makes them ideal for creating lasting family memories in Mallorca.
